I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Flight Centre Travel Group (Melbourne) in May 2015
Interview
Appeared a group interview with six of us altogether. First, they showed you a video about Flight Centre for about 10 minutes, then the manager explained about the role and the software they use to book flights. After that, an assessment of about 20 minutes took place. It was interesting because I did not find anything like this glassdoor before. I went everyone's experience in glassdoor before the interview and I thought I was well prepared but I did not see this coming. Anyway, we had to go through a case study first, then pick up the best travel plan according to the case and finally book off the required flight details use the handbook provided. There is only one answer to this exercise and I think none of us got through.
